Storytime: Celebrating the Lights of Diversity

In the northern hemisphere, during long dark winter nights, diverse festivals provide many opportunities to kindle hope by welcoming light. We'll enjoy the library lit for many winter celebrations and highlight some of them by sharing stories of how some families, cultures and religions welcome light and keep hope alive with their candles, lanterns, lit trees, menorahs, kinaras, and strings of lights aglow.

Room H/Children’s Diversity & Justice Library. Inside the Tennessee Valley Unitarian Universalist Church, 2931 Kingston Pike, Knoxville, TN.
